The new ep from Familjen is too big for just one label. It's taken the work of both Hybris and Adrian Recordings to release this to the world. This ep is a precursor to a new Familjen lp to be released in the first quarter of 2007. Interestingly the marketing plan asks you to download the songs, and them burn them onto a "disc of plastic" and then find the artwork for the album cover in cafe's, stores and boutiques in and around Gothenburg, Malmo and Stockholm.(Elektro Hoe) Genre : Electronica Mp3 : [...]
